Posting Summary | The University of Vermont (UVM) is seeking a full-time Assistant Director to lead the team supporting animal research and research using biohazardous materials. The Assistant Director will report to the Research Protections Office which is the unit responsible for administering the University’s Institutional Animal Care and Use Committee (IACUC), Institutional Biosafety Committee (IBC), Controlled Substance Committee (CSC), and the Institutional Review Boards (IRB). The Assistant Director will provide administrative oversight of all IACUC, IBC, and CSC research compliance activities. Key responsibilities include: · Administrative operations to include staffing, communications and website presence, software evaluation · Committee administration requiring subject matter expertise, institutional leadership liaising, policy and procedure development, advisee · Education, Communication and Outreach by leading and executing educational outreach activities, providing leadership in implementing communication strategies and principles for internal and external communications, participation in professional networking and collaborations · Quality and Oversight to include development and supervision of post approval monitoring programs, principle in non-compliance investigations, metrics review and procedural improvements The Research Protections Office has been delegated authority and responsibility by the Vice President for Research to administer research compliance areas at UVM including human subjects research, vertebrate animal research, recombinant DNA and biohazardous research, including viruses requiring high-containment, and research utilizing controlled substances. This position has primary responsibility for providing specialized administrative support, regulatory compliance review and management of regulatory committees which include the Institutional Animal Care and Use Committee (IACUC), Institutional Biosafety Committee (IBC) and the Controlled Substances Committee (CSC). The position ensures operational needs are being met, appropriate compliance with regulations, institutional and accrediting agency requirements, develops policies and procedures, and is first contact with our external regulators. |
